在宁夏这片土地上,我有幸目睹了校友会管理平台的构建过程,这不仅仅是一次技术实践,更是一次对大学精神的致敬。在这个过程中,我们团队的目标是创造一个既实用又高效的平台,助力校友在职业道路上不断前行。
需求分析与设计
首先,我们需要明确校友会管理平台的基本需求:信息共享、活动组织、资源链接以及职业发展支持。通过深入调研,我们确定了以下核心功能:
个人资料管理:包括基本信息、工作经历、教育背景等。
活动发布与参与:方便用户发布或参与各类线上线下的活动。
资源分享:提供行业资讯、职位信息、培训课程等资源。
职业发展支持:设置职业规划、简历优化、面试技巧等模块。
技术选型与实现
我们选择了Python作为后端开发语言,借助Django框架构建高效、安全的Web应用。前端则使用React进行开发,确保界面响应式且用户体验流畅。数据库采用MySQL存储用户数据和活动信息。
在实现个人资料管理时,我们设计了一个简洁的表单,允许用户输入和编辑个人信息。通过RESTful API接口,用户可以轻松地查询和修改自己的资料。为了增强安全性,我们实现了OAuth2.0授权机制,确保只有经过验证的用户才能访问敏感信息。
案例研究与展望
通过实际案例,我们发现校友会管理平台极大地增强了校友之间的联系,促进了职业机会的交流与合作。未来,我们计划进一步集成AI推荐系统,根据用户的兴趣和需求智能匹配相关资源,为校友的职业发展提供更加个性化的支持。
总结而言,构建校友会管理平台不仅是一项技术挑战,更是连接过去与未来的桥梁。它不仅记录了大学时代的美好回忆,还为校友提供了持续成长与发展的平台。在这个过程中,我们深感自豪与满足,期待未来能有更多创新与突破,为校友会管理带来新的活力与价值。